| if you have a comforter or a throw pillow or anything you like the colors in, you can go to to hardware store and they can match the color by computer so you can get the colors to match you furniture, cutains, comforter, anything you like and want to work with in your home. I learned the hard way that you should never pick colors when you are stressed, upset, or emotional. I picked this blue that looked great on paper, horrible on the walls, when I was upset about something. (THe painter was coming the next day) We had to repaint it looked so bad! Just remember everything looks DARKER on the wall then you think it will.... Paint a patch on the wall... let it dry, and look at it every hour or so all day long, because the light in a room changes as the day goes by.... what looks great in the morning may look to dark in the afternoon!
